聚焦“大魔王”麻酱素毛肚大单品,盐津铺子与六必居签署十年战略合作
Core Viewpoint - Salted Fish Shop and Liu Bi Ju have entered a ten-year strategic partnership to promote traditional Chinese food culture through the development of a new product line centered around sesame sauce konjac products [1][2]. Group 1: Strategic Partnership - The strategic cooperation agreement will be effective from October 16, 2025, and will last for ten years, focusing on the co-creation of sesame sauce konjac products [1]. - The collaboration aims to enhance both companies' market influence and value by combining traditional craftsmanship with innovative flavors [1]. Group 2: Product Development and Market Performance - Salted Fish Shop has launched its first strategic sub-brand "Da Mo Wang," which achieved over 1 billion yuan in sales within a year, becoming the company's top-selling product [2]. - The "Da Mo Wang" sesame sauce konjac has shown strong performance across various sales channels, including membership, convenience stores, and online platforms, contributing to a significant increase in sales efficiency for distributors [2]. - In the first half of 2025, the leisure konjac product segment generated revenue of 791 million yuan, marking a year-on-year growth of 155.10% and accounting for 26.90% of the company's total revenue [2]. Group 3: Market Expansion and Innovation - The "Da Mo Wang" sesame sauce konjac has successfully entered mainstream markets in North America and Southeast Asia, serving as a new model for Chinese flavors going global [3]. - The company is expanding its product matrix around the core flavor of sesame sauce, developing various derivative products such as garlic sesame sauce konjac and sesame sauce spicy tripe [3].
核心财务数据“打架”大客户疑存关联关系 齐云山食品赴港上市疑云重重
Zhong Zheng Wang· 2025-10-15 03:15
Core Viewpoint - Jiangxi Qiyunshan Food Co., Ltd. has submitted an application for listing on the Hong Kong Stock Exchange, showcasing impressive financial metrics, particularly in gross margin and operating cash flow, compared to its industry peers [1][2]. Financial Performance - The company's total revenue has shown a growth trend from 2022 to 2024, with figures of 217 million, 247 million, and 339 million yuan respectively [2]. - The flagship product, South Jujube Cake, has been the largest contributor to revenue, with sales of 193 million, 209 million, and 294 million yuan during the same period [2]. - The gross margins for Qiyunshan Food from 2022 to 2024 were 47.2%, 48.8%, and 48.6%, significantly higher than the industry leader, Liuliu Guoyuan, whose gross margin is projected to drop to 36% in 2024 [1][3]. Pricing and Sales Dynamics - There is a discrepancy in the average selling price of South Jujube Cake, reported as decreasing from 40.5 yuan/kg in 2023 to either 39.3 yuan/kg or 34.3 yuan/kg in 2024, indicating potential pricing strategies or reporting inconsistencies [1][6]. - The company has expanded its distribution network, increasing the number of offline distributors from 140 in December 2022 to 199 by December 2024 [2]. Customer Structure and Relationships - Qiyunshan Food relies heavily on bulk snack channels, similar to Liuliu Guoyuan, which often require manufacturers to offer discounts [2]. - The company has a significant reliance on a local distributor, identified as Customer A, which has consistently been its largest customer from 2022 to 2024 [7]. - There are indications of potential conflicts of interest, as Customer A may have ties to Qiyunshan Food through shared ownership and management [7]. Raw Material Costs - Both Qiyunshan Food and Liuliu Guoyuan face similar raw material cost structures, with slight variations in the prices of their main ingredients [4][5]. - The price of South Jujube and green plums increased by 0.1 yuan/kg in 2024 compared to 2023, while sugar prices decreased for both companies [4]. Market Position and Risks - Despite lower brand recognition and revenue compared to Liuliu Guoyuan, Qiyunshan Food maintains a stable high gross margin, raising questions about the sustainability of its financial performance amidst industry challenges [3][5]. - Concerns have been raised regarding the potential for inflated revenue or reduced costs, especially if the company's gross margin continues to exceed industry averages without clear competitive advantages [6].
研判2025!中国南酸枣糕行业市场政策、产业链、市场规模、竞争格局及发展趋势分析:齐云山食品一枝独秀[图]
Chan Ye Xin Xi Wang· 2025-10-15 01:33
Core Insights - The demand for natural, low-sugar, and functional snacks is increasing due to rising national income levels and health awareness, with the market for South Jujube Cake expected to reach 1.758 billion yuan in 2024, a year-on-year growth of 38.65% [1][4][8] - The industry is experiencing a trend towards high-end products, with premium gift packaging growing rapidly, providing higher profit margins for companies and driving product structure upgrades [1][4][8] Overview - South Jujube, also known as Five-Eyed Fruit, is a plant from the Anacardiaceae family, with edible fruit that has a sweet and sour taste. It has medicinal properties such as detoxification and calming effects [2][4] - South Jujube Cake is primarily made from South Jujube fruit (≥30%) without added gelling agents, produced through various processes including selection, washing, and drying [2][4] Market Policies - Recent policies in China emphasize food safety, ensuring the quality and safety of South Jujube Cake products, and promoting the industry towards standardization and high quality [4][5] Industry Chain - The upstream of the South Jujube Cake industry includes suppliers of raw materials like South Jujube, sugar, and packaging materials, while the midstream consists of production companies, and the downstream includes sales channels such as supermarkets and e-commerce [6][7] Consumer Insights - Female consumers dominate the market, accounting for over 55%, with the core consumer group aged 25-35 years, representing 47%. Health attributes are the primary consideration for about 80% of consumers when choosing products [8] - Consumers prefer products that are low in sugar, free from additives, and rich in vitamins and minerals, with a strong preference for a balanced sweet and sour taste [8] Competitive Landscape - The South Jujube Cake industry is concentrated in regions like Jiangxi, Guangdong, and Hunan, with Jiangxi being the largest production area [9][10] - The market is characterized by high concentration, with the top three companies holding a market share of 53.4% in 2024. Jiangxi Qiyunshan Food Co., Ltd. leads the market with a 32.4% share [10][11] Company Profiles - Jiangxi Qiyunshan Food Co., Ltd. focuses on the development of natural and healthy South Jujube products, with a revenue of 339 million yuan in 2024, of which 294 million yuan comes from South Jujube Cake [10][11] - Jiangxi Wanzai Qinnian Food Co., Ltd. is a modern food production company with a range of products, including the "Qinnian" brand series, which is popular across major cities in China [11] Development Trends - Future trends in the South Jujube Cake industry include the introduction of new flavors and functional products, as well as diverse forms such as freeze-dried and chewable types to cater to various consumer needs [12]
